Output d89036de81df57074b2773da9a596d990ad87cefd22d0ab32187dd3b9449398a:0

value
420000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ad80af95147a40ed29d0469ca9f892acf6870cf OP_EQUALVERIFY OP_CHECKSIG
address
1Df94PrtfZmKcfFnBn2Tf5eCZaA8ryfYMh
transaction
d89036de81df57074b2773da9a596d990ad87cefd22d0ab32187dd3b9449398a
spent
true